# Artifact Signing — PointsLedger

All PointsLedger release artifacts are signed during the Tallygrove CI pipeline before promotion to staging. Reviewers must confirm the signature step ran and that the digest matches the build manifest. Unsigned ledger builds must be rejected outright. When verifying a candidate artifact locally, check it against the active signing key below.

deploy key for kajof-yawif: bky9_fvxrpdHPq

// WAVEFORM_PREVIEW_BUCKETS defines how many amplitude buckets the
// Tonereef host renders when drawing the preview strip for a clip.
// Plugin authors: your analyzer output is downsampled to this bucket
// count before display, so returning finer resolution wastes cycles.
// The host clamps anything above this value and logs a warning once
// per session. If your previews look blocky, check your sample-rate
// handling first, not this constant. This default was tuned against
// the build recorded just below.

pipeline stamp: htk9_ce63042d9

### Changed defaults — Tidewick i18n module v4.1

Date rendering now localizes by default instead of falling back to ISO formatting. The detected locale drives short/long date patterns; explicit overrides still win. Week-start and numeral shaping also follow the locale. Release manager note: roll this behind the format flag for the first wave. The shipped default configuration follows below.

deployment values, yadug-bawif:
[framir]
team = pelox
access_code = ac_a38ab2
owner = tamion.julael
host = framir.tolvaqlabs.test
port = 11211
peer = tammir.zemvargrid.local
salt = 2215ef03
pin = 1541

## Authentication

Post-upgrade, Quillbroker 4.x rejects legacy basic auth. All consumers must present a service key via the `X-Quill-Key` header. If queues stall after cutover, restart the relay pods first, then verify the key. Rotation happens quarterly; the current key is valid through this cycle. Use the key below for the on-call relay account.

gateway credential: zpat4_626B